Inputting characters
On this unit, you can change the name displayed on the following screens
to the names that you prefer.
0
Friendly Name (v p. 104)
0
Character input for the network functions
Using the number buttons
1
Display the screen for inputting characters.
0
To change a character, use o p to align the cursor with the
character that you want to change.
2
Press +10 to select the character type (upper case,
lower case, characters with diacritical marks or
numeric characters).
3
Use 0 – 9, +10 until the desired character is displayed.
0
The types of characters that can be input are as shown in the
following table.

4
Repeat steps 2 and 3 to input characters then press
ENTER to register it.
